CVE-2020-24222HIGH 7.8

Buffer Overflow vulnerability in jfif_decode() function in rockcarry ffjpeg through version 1.0.0, allows local attackers to execute arbitrary code due to an issue with ALIGN.

CVE-2022-28471MEDIUM 6.5

In ffjpeg (commit hash: caade60), the function bmp_load() in bmp.c contains an integer overflow vulnerability, which eventually results in the heap overflow in jfif_encode() in jfif.c. This is due to the incomplete patch for issue 38

CVE-2021-34122MEDIUM 5.5

The function bitstr_tell at bitstr.c in ffjpeg commit 4ab404e has a NULL pointer dereference.

CVE-2021-45385MEDIUM 6.5

A Null Pointer Dereference vulnerability exits in ffjpeg d5cfd49 (2021-12-06) in bmp_load(). When the size information in metadata of the bmp is out of range, it returns without assign memory buffer to `pb->pdata` and did not exit the program. So the program crashes when it tries to access the pb->data, in jfif_encode() at jfif.c:763. This is due to the incomplete patch for CVE-2020-13438.
